You can manage delisting in two ways:
Automatically through Inventory Sync settings
Manually from Products Page
This allows you to decide whether listings should stay visible, become inactive, or be removed completely.
Automatic Delisting from Inventory Sync Settings
Inside Inventory Sync Settings, you can define what happens when the quantity reaches to 0 or no longer available on the source store.
Choose one of the following options depending on how you want listings handled.
1. Close Listings
Keeps the listing saved on the marketplace but hides it from buyers. You can reopen it later when stock returns.
2. Set Listing Quantity to 0
Keeps the listing visible but marks it as out of stock. Customers can still see it depending on the platform, but customers cannot buy it.
3. Delete Listings
Removes the listing completely from the marketplace. If you want to sell it again later, you must export the item again.
Manual Delisting from Products Page
You can manually remove listings at any time, either for a single product or multiple products in bulk.
This gives you full control over delisting products on the target marketplace. After delisting, the product status changes from Listed & Syncing to Ready.
Steps
Go to Products page
Select one or multiple listings
Click End & Delete Listings
Confirm the action by entering the displayed number.
The selected listings will be removed or updated based on the delist option you choose, and their status will change to Ready.
